About [(4aR,7aS)-4-methyl-2,3,4a,5,7,7a-hexahydropyrrolo[3,4-b][1,4]oxazin-6-yl]-(furan-3-yl)methanone;2,2,2-trifluoroacetic acid

[(4aR,7aS)-4-methyl-2,3,4a,5,7,7a-hexahydropyrrolo[3,4-b][1,4]oxazin-6-yl]-(furan-3-yl)methanone;2,2,2-trifluoroacetic acid (PubChem CID 127022642) has the molecular formula C14H17F3N2O5 and a molecular weight of 350.29 g/mol. Its IUPAC name is [(4aR,7aS)-4-methyl-2,3,4a,5,7,7a-hexahydropyrrolo[3,4-b][1,4]oxazin-6-yl]-(furan-3-yl)methanone;2,2,2-trifluoroacetic acid.
